"System Information" (In case
of Windows XP)
Open
"System Information"
- Click "Start" -
"Programs" -
"Accessories" -
"System Tools" -
"System Information", then
"System Information" will
run.
- Export "System
Information"
Click "File" –
"Export".
Choose where you save in and type a file name, and
then click "Save" button.

How to check Version of
DirectX
- Open "System
Information"
Click "Start" -
"Programs" -
"Accessories" -
"System Tools" -
"System Information", then
"System Information" will
run.
- Start DirectX Diagnostic Tool
Click "Tools"- "Start
DirectX Diagnostic Tool".
- Check Version of DirectX
Click "System" Tag, and check
DirectX Version in System Information.
